Narasaki Sangyo Co., Ltd. "Functional Materials Division" specializes in high-performance material contract processing. The materials we handle fall into "five categories": 1. Ceramics/Glass 2. Metals 3. Engineering Plastics 4. Carbon 5. Surface Treatment We offer a wide range of services, and if you provide us with a single production drawing, we can deliver various materials and surface treatments as a one-stop solution. We cater to everything from general-purpose to specialty materials, including high-precision, fine, electrical discharge, laser processing, as well as surface treatments such as coating, precision cleaning, and blasting. Our particular strength lies in high-precision and short-lead-time processing of ceramics. By machining from pre-fired materials, we achieve short lead times for ceramics that traditionally take several months. We handle a wide range of ceramics, including machinable ceramics like Hotovel, as well as fine ceramics such as alumina and zirconia, and non-oxide ceramics like silicon carbide, silicon nitride, and aluminum nitride. We are also actively engaged in proposing cost reductions for overseas ceramics and other international materials. We can accommodate various contract processing projects, from prototype development starting with a quantity of one to mass production.
